Output 312d25934b29b29e3ff533f39245793b6ee199ab174d6d7188b4b6ed34ff6e29:0

value
774582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a8ef5704a29768163fda94906be052aa9b6040 OP_EQUAL
address
3AmyCLcxVDWKLhFhPcMjZLTwZK88TTNth9
transaction
312d25934b29b29e3ff533f39245793b6ee199ab174d6d7188b4b6ed34ff6e29
confirmations
377548
spent
true